Dying.<\/strong><\/p>\n<p style=\"padding-left: 40px;\">In Lineage 2 if you died you lost experience and could even de-level.\u00a0 You had a chance of dropping gear (more on how bad this was later). You&#8217;re only rez choice was &#8216;return to village&#8217; which meant running all the way back to your current location.\u00a0 \u00a0No item durability loss.<\/p>\n<p style=\"padding-left: 40px;\">In WoW, you died and your equipment took some durability loss.\u00a0 Didn&#8217;t drop gear, didn&#8217;t lose exp, and could corpse run.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Lineage 2 wins at the worst dying.\u00a0<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><strong>2. Money.<\/strong><\/p>\n<p style=\"padding-left: 40px;\">I heard money was hard to get in WoW but I am not clear on exactly HOW hard.<\/p>\n<p style=\"padding-left: 40px;\">I remember being level 20ish with 16k on me.\u00a0 A D grade weapon (levels 20 and up) cost around 400k.<\/p>\n<p><strong>I am not positive but I think L2 wins<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><strong>3.\u00a0 Gear<\/strong><\/p>\n<p style=\"padding-left: 40px;\">In Lineage 2 you did not get gear from mob drops.\u00a0 You did not get gear from quests.\u00a0 You did not get gear from rare mobs.\u00a0 Raids didn&#8217;t exist yet.\u00a0 You either bought gear from stores, which had limited supplies past NG (no grade, level 1 and up) or have a dwarf craft it for you.\u00a0 Crafting was tedious and expensive.\u00a0 The only reliable gear was some nub-grade jewelry you could get in some starting areas off low level mobs.\u00a0 If you ever lost a weapon by a scam or dropping while dying, YOU WERE SCREWED.\u00a0 Your power came 99% from your weapons.<\/p>\n<p>\u00a0 \u00a0 \u00a0 \u00a0 \u00a0As I mentioned I did not play vanilla WoW but, I am pretty certain gear dropped from mobs once in a while, quests gave gear rewards, the raids gave gear. You could kill stuff by punching it or if you were a caster, still hit stuff with spells at least a little. I think.\u00a0 Update: I was able to play a bit of classic, I did get gear prior to level 5 from a quest.<\/p>\n<p><strong>L2 wins.\u00a0<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><strong>4.\u00a0 Scams<\/strong><\/p>\n<p style=\"padding-left: 40px;\">Lineage 2 had such excessive scamming that I wrote a guide detailing it out to help people avoid it.\u00a0 Low level items that looked the same as higher level or higher priced goods, shop scams, trade window scams, player name font scams, loot method scams, you name it.\u00a0 It was especially prevalent because of these flaws AND because the GMs did nothing about it.<\/p>\n<p style=\"padding-left: 40px;\">Many scams simply cannot be done in WoW thanks to bind-on-pickup gear and other soulbound items.\u00a0 The trade window one still worked, and loot ninjas were a thing.\u00a0 But, the GMs would punish you if you did a scam which stopped a good majority of them and loot ninjas were labeled and punished by the community.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Lineage 2 scams were much, much worse.\u00a0<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><strong>5. Transferring items<\/strong><\/p>\n<p style=\"padding-left: 40px;\">Lineage 2 literally didn&#8217;t have a mail system of any kind for many, many years.\u00a0 If you wanted to trade something from one of your characters to another, you had to find a secluded area on the map and log one character out there.\u00a0 Then log in the character with the stuff and get to the same spot.\u00a0 Then, I kid you not, you had to DROP THE GEAR ON THE GROUND, quickly log out, log in the other character, and spam pick up and hope you got it.\u00a0 Seriously.\u00a0 I use to drop stuff in rivers to hide it to do this.<\/p>\n<p style=\"padding-left: 40px;\">WoW had a mail system between characters right out of the gate so, do I even need to say it?<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p><strong>6. Travel<\/strong><\/p>\n<p style=\"padding-left: 40px;\">Lineage 2 had boat travel between the Talking Island starter area, Gludin and Giran, and instant Gatekeeper ports to areas and towns.\u00a0 In early expansions though no one could afford ports and had to run everywhere.\u00a0 We even ran under the ocean to get between towns because the boat was expensive and buggy.\u00a0 \u00a0In the entire time I played, I never had a player mount.\u00a0 They had to be upgraded through experience and quests from a hatchling to a strider, required food and armor to survive, and could die forever, besides all of that.\u00a0 There was no porting ability like blink, dash, leap, etc.\u00a0 \u00a0I remember wanting to cry during the 2nd class change quests when I had to go across the entire map over and over BY RUNNING.\u00a0 It was so bad in later expansions the quests gave you &#8216;dimension diamonds&#8217; that let you trade for town specific portal scrolls but in very limited supply.\u00a0 However, regular quests were generally in a nearby zone and certainly not across the world.<\/p>\n<p style=\"padding-left: 40px;\">WoW had mounts at level 40 that didn&#8217;t need food, didn&#8217;t die, and didn&#8217;t require exp.\u00a0 Flight points took time but as far as I know, they weren&#8217;t cost prohibitive to use. (Update since playing Classic.\u00a0 WoW mounts at 40 cost A LOT of gold.\u00a0 You probably won&#8217;t have enough at 40 on your first character.\u00a0 Flight points can be expensive, like half a gold to fly to where you need to be.\u00a0 Lots of basic quests send you across the ocean or entire continent.)<\/p>\n<p><strong>I think both games are about even here.\u00a0\u00a0<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><strong>7.\u00a0 Crafting and enchanting systems<\/strong><\/p>\n<p style=\"padding-left: 40px;\">Put aside the fact that L2 required hundreds of materials to make an item, it had recipes that had 70% and 60% success rates and recipes you needed extra copies for. Not even kidding.\u00a0 If you wanted to craft a 60% item, which was often the only way you could because some items did not have a 100% recipe, you not only needed a copy of the recipe for yourself, and the crafter also needed a recipe, but you COULD FAIL.\u00a0 That meant you lost the recipe and ALL THE MATS, if you failed. And for the longest time you couldn&#8217;t tell if it worked or not, you would give all your materials to a crafter who could SUCCEED, but tell you it failed and keep your stuff.\u00a0 And you had no idea if it worked or not. And some recipes took ages to even get.\u00a0 I legit (almost) cried when I turned in the Tower of Insolence floor plans for all 13 floors and it gave me a handful of materials AND NOT THE RECIPE.\u00a0 You could do a quest for weeks and not even get what you wanted.<\/p>\n<p style=\"padding-left: 40px;\">I don&#8217;t know how WoW&#8217;s crafting worked in vanilla but I am going to guess it&#8217;s 100% not like L2&#8217;s. (Update from classic, no, L2 was definitely worse)<\/p>\n<p><strong>8. Raids<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Lineage 2 didn&#8217;t have raids at all that I can recall at all until the Cruma Tower Core in C1 or 2 and the Ant Queen.\u00a0 However, no one was a high enough level to try either of those until well into Chronicle 2 since they were level 50 something.\u00a0 They weren&#8217;t made for a US audience either because they required ridiculous number of players (like 50 to 100) we just didn&#8217;t have.\u00a0 They weren&#8217;t raids in the instanced sense either, they were all world bosses.\u00a0 If it was killed on your server, no one could do it until it respawned.\u00a0 We did have mini world bosses though. They often dropped nothing at all or useless stuff though.\u00a0 In C3 we did an actual legit world\u00a0 boss raid for the first time and it dropped no joke, 397 stems.\u00a0 Stems were a very base crafting material.\u00a0 It would be like getting 300 mage cloth from Ragnoros or something.<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p>If I recall correctly, Classic WoW had some actual raids, like Onyxia and AQ? I believe raids were 40 people as well.\u00a0 They were only available to max level players though.<\/p>\n<p><strong>I think both games are probably on par for 2004 raiding though. Other than WoW not making you lose gear or exp during raid wipes though.\u00a0<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p><strong>L2 wins at being hardcore.\u00a0<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p>If I think of more later I&#8217;ll add it.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Last night I tried to get into the classic version of WoW, but it had me sit in a queue, choose an account, then put me in a queue again.\u00a0 For a solid hour.\u00a0 So, that didn&#8217;t happen.\u00a0 There was a discussion that classic WoW was &#8216;hardcore&#8217; but c&#8217;mon.\u00a0 Really?\u00a0 Now, I only played it [&hellip;]<\/p>\n","protected":false},"author":1,"featured_media":0,"comment_status":"closed","ping_status":"open","sticky":false,"template":"","format":"standard","meta":{"footnotes":""},"categories":[1],"tags":[],"class_list":["post-6043","post","type-post","status-publish","format-standard","hentry","category-pvp"],"_links":{"self":[{"href":"https:\/\/ocyla.catchmehooking.com\/index.php?rest_route=\/wp\/v2\/posts\/6043","targetHints":{"allow":["GET"]}}],"collection":[{"href":"https:\/\/ocyla.catchmehooking.com\/index.php?rest_route=\/wp\/v2\/posts"}],"about":[{"href":"https:\/\/ocyla.catchmehooking.com\/index.php?rest_route=\/wp\/v2\/types\/post"}],"author":[{"emb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/ocyla.catchmehooking.com\/index.php?rest_route=\/wp\/v2\/users\/1"}],"replies":[{"emb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/ocyla.catchmehooking.com\/index.php?rest_route=%2Fwp%2Fv2%2Fcomments&post=6043"}],"version-history":[{"count":4,"href":"https:\/\/ocyla.catchmehooking.com\/index.php?rest_route=\/wp\/v2\/posts\/6043\/revisions"}],"predecessor-version":[{"id":6117,"href":"https:\/\/ocyla.catchmehooking.com\/index.php?rest_route=\/wp\/v2\/posts\/6043\/revisions\/6117"}],"wp:attachment":[{"href":"https:\/\/ocyla.catchmehooking.com\/index.php?rest_route=%2Fwp%2Fv2%2Fmedia&parent=6043"}],"wp:term":[{"taxonomy":"category","emb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/ocyla.catchmehooking.com\/index.php?rest_route=%2Fwp%2Fv2%2Fcategories&post=6043"},{"taxonomy":"post_tag","emb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/ocyla.catchmehooking.com\/index.php?rest_route=%2Fwp%2Fv2%2Ftags&post=6043"}],"curies":[{"name":"wp","href":"https:\/\/api.w.org\/{rel}","templated":true}]}}
